Explorar el Código

Merge branch 'dev-project' into dev

jinx hace 2 meses
padre
commit
90a4153b98
Se han modificado 6 ficheros con 15 adiciones y 12743 borrados
  1. 2 1
      .env
  2. 4 5
      .env.development
  3. 0 12731
      package-lock.json
  4. 3 3
      src/components/header/index.vue
  5. 2 1
      src/pages/SViewer.vue
  6. 4 2
      src/pages/Viewer.vue

+ 2 - 1
.env

@@ -1,9 +1,10 @@
 # 静态资源地址
 VUE_APP_CDN_URL=https://4dkk.4dage.com/v4/www/
 # sdk文件地址
-VUE_APP_SDK_DIR=https://4dkk.4dage.com/v4-test/www/sdk/
+VUE_APP_SDK_DIR=https://4dkk.4dage.com/v4/www/sdk/
 # 激光接口地址
 VUE_APP_LASER_URL=https://laser.4dkankan.com/backend/
+
 # 静态资源目录
 VUE_APP_STATIC_DIR=static
 # 场景资源地址

+ 4 - 5
.env.development

@@ -1,9 +1,8 @@
 VUE_APP_TEST=1
-VUE_APP_CDN_URL=https://oss.4dkankan.jp/v4-test/www/
-VUE_APP_RESOURCE_URL=https://oss.4dkankan.jp/
+VUE_APP_CDN_URL=https://4dkk.4dage.com/v4/www/
+VUE_APP_RESOURCE_URL=https://4dkk.4dage.com/
 # 激光接口地址
-VUE_APP_DEV_PROXY=https://test-jp.4dkankan.com/
-#VUE_APP_LASER_URL=https://uat-laser.4dkankan.com/
-  VUE_APP_LASER_URL=https://testlaser-jp.4dkankan.com/backend/
+VUE_APP_DEV_PROXY=https://test.4dkankan.com/
+VUE_APP_LASER_URL=https://uat-laser.4dkankan.com/
 #环境区分
 #VUE_APP_ENV=jp

La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 12731
package-lock.json


+ 3 - 3
src/components/header/index.vue

@@ -8,7 +8,7 @@
     </header>
     <header v-else>
         <div v-if="project">{{ project.projectName }}</div>
-        <div class="user">
+        <div class="user" v-if="!isClear">
             <ul>
                 <li>
                     <div class="language">
@@ -72,7 +72,7 @@ import CopyLink from './CopyLink'
 import sync from '@/utils/sync'
 import { useI18n, getLocale } from '@/i18n'
 import math from '@/utils/math.js'
-
+const isClear = ref(browser.urlHasValue('clear'))
 const { t } = useI18n({ useScope: 'global' })
 const props = defineProps({
     project: Object,
@@ -254,7 +254,7 @@ watchEffect(() => {
         if (props.project && props.project.panos) {
             points.value.p1 = props.project.panos.p1
             points.value.p2 = props.project.panos.p2
-            console.log('------load---------',points.value)
+            console.log('------load---------', points.value)
         }
     }
 })

+ 2 - 1
src/pages/SViewer.vue

@@ -1,7 +1,7 @@
 <template>
     <main>
         <iframe ref="sourceFrame" v-if="sourceURL" :src="sourceURL" frameborder="0" @load="onLoadSource"></iframe>
-        <div class="model" v-show="!showAdjust">
+        <div class="model" v-show="!showAdjust && !isClear">
             <div class="bim" :class="{ active: bimChecked, disable: project && !project.bimData }">
                 <div @click="onBimChecked">
                     <i class="iconfont icon-BIM"></i>
@@ -49,6 +49,7 @@ let panoData
 
 // 是否BIM模式
 const showBim = ref(browser.urlHasValue('bim'))
+const isClear = ref(browser.urlHasValue('clear'))
 const showBimTips = ref(false)
 const showTips = ref(null)
 const showDensity = ref(false)

+ 4 - 2
src/pages/Viewer.vue

@@ -6,7 +6,7 @@
         <main>
             <div class="split">
                 <iframe ref="sourceFrame" v-if="sourceURL" :src="sourceURL" frameborder="0" @load="onLoadSource"></iframe>
-                <div class="tools" v-if="source && !showRules && !ruleChecked" v-show="showWidget && !showAdjust && !fscChecked && (dbsChecked || (!target && !bimChecked))">
+                <div class="tools" v-if="source && !showRules && !ruleChecked && !isClear" v-show="showWidget && !showAdjust && !fscChecked && (dbsChecked || (!target && !bimChecked))">
                     <div class="item-date">
                         <calendar
                             name="source"
@@ -71,7 +71,7 @@
                     </div>
                 </div>
             </div>
-            <div class="model" v-show="showWidget && !showAdjust && !showRules">
+            <div class="model" v-show="showWidget && !showAdjust && !showRules && !isClear">
                 <div class="rule" :class="{ active: ruleChecked, disable: fileDisable }" v-show="!fscChecked && !showBim && !dbsChecked && !bimChecked">
                     <div @click="onRuleChecked">
                         <i class="iconfont icon-measurement"></i>
@@ -156,6 +156,7 @@ const closeRules = () => {
 
 // 是否BIM模式
 const showBim = ref(browser.urlHasValue('bim'))
+const isClear = ref(browser.urlHasValue('clear'))
 // 是否校准模式
 const showSplit = ref(browser.urlHasValue('split'))
 const showAdjust = ref(browser.urlHasValue('adjust'))
@@ -762,6 +763,7 @@ const getInfo = () => {
                     project.value = response.data
                     if (showBim.value) {
                         onBimChecked()
+                        onDbsChecked()
                     } else if (project.value.sceneList.length) {
                         if (num) {
                             source.value = project.value.sceneList.find(c => c.num == num)